Lucius was the Tower Master of Radiant Thunder, while Lorianne was the name of the Tower Master of Verdant Spring.

Lucius appeared somewhat embarrassed by the comment made by the Tower Master of Land Academy, referencing the events of the last regional war.

In the previous session, the Divine Tower of Verdant Spring lost nearly four thousand initiates in the trial space, many at the hands of the Divine Tower of Shadow and the Divine Tower of Radiant Thunder.

Together, these two divine towers were responsible for escalating the casualty rate of the Divine Tower of Verdant Spring by twenty percent in the last war.

The strategy of the Divine Tower of Shadow seemed to have been premeditated by its academy deans, a tactical choice to target perceived weaker adversaries.

However, the aggressive tactics of the Divine Tower of Radiant Thunder in the previous Regional Inter-Academy War were not directly linked to the decisions of its tower master or deans.

The primary reason for their assertiveness was the emergence of an exceptional figure within their ranks that year.

Martinez, nicknamed the Elector Commander, emerged as a dark horse in the last war. He not only dominated the five major divine towers’ territories but also ultimately secured the top spot in the standings.

Martinez’s extreme personality was shaped by his early life experiences.

Born into a struggling noble house, he faced numerous challenges before joining the Divine Tower of Radiant Thunder at the age of fifty.

Back then, he was only an intermediate initiate.

His relentless pursuit of power, coupled with his exceptional affinity for the electro element, propelled his meteoric rise within the Divine Tower of Radiant Thunder.

In just over a decade, Martinez became a Quasi Mage and represented the Divine Tower of Radiant Thunder in the Regional Inter-Divine Tower Academy War.

If Martinez had shown a willingness to communicate with others or lead the other initiates in earning points, the Divine Tower of Radiant Thunder might have secured the first place in the last academy war.

Initiates like him were often met with a mix of admiration and resentment, irrespective of the divine tower they hailed from.

Now formally apprenticed to the Tower Master of Radiant Thunder, a distinguished Rank Five mage specializing in electro magic spells, Martinez was perceived as a successor to Lucius’ faction.

Consequently, the Tower Master of Land Academy’s allusions to the previous war, particularly those about his new apprentice, made Lucius somewhat uncomfortable.

Compared to his apprentice’s colder demeanor, Lucius was a more amiable figure.

In fact, all the five divine tower masters in this region were easy-going people and maintained cordial relations with each other.

This included the somewhat somber Tower Master of Shadow, who had been a great help to Lorianne during the early stages of the Divine Tower of Verdant Spring’s construction.

For the esteemed tower masters, the conflicts and skirmishes among initiates in the Regional Inter-Divine Tower Academy Wars would not impact their friendships with each other.

They viewed the event much like a training they had set up for their initiates—akin to watching ants they had nurtured fighting against each other.

These tower masters might take note of the most exceptional initiates, occasionally rewarding those who stood out for their strength and skills.

Being accepted as a disciple by the Tower Master of the Divine Tower of Radiant Thunder was an uncommon privilege, and for Martinez, the top initiate of the last war, it was a recognition that matched his extraordinary skills and performance.

The question from the Tower Master of Shadow was largely influenced by the presence of the Summer Guardian.

Had the Summer Guardian not chanced upon the region where the five divine towers stood, it was likely that none of the tower masters gathered here above the trial space would have paid much heed to the ongoing regional academy war.

Indeed, Martinez was only accepted as an apprentice by the Tower Master of Radiant Thunder post-war.

On that particular day, the Tower Master of Radiant Thunder had just emerged from his laboratory after completing a significant research experiment. While he was in high spirits, he was informed of Martinez’s exceptional performance and decided to take him under his wing.

(Author’s Note: Under normal circumstances, the Regional Inter-Divine Tower Academy Wars are overseen by the deans of various divine tower academies. The tower masters generally do not engage in these affairs, considering them to be minor. Hence, the outcomes and rankings of these wars serve as key indicators of their deans’ capabilities.)

“Hehe, it seems I may have come across a promising initiate this time. Let’s see how he fares,” the Summer Guardian remarked with a chuckle.

The other tower masters followed her gaze, which was fixed on the scene below.

Although the Summer Guardian had previously announced plans to visit the Western Archipelago, she showed no immediate inclination to leave.

The four guardians of the Magus World, each known to the tower masters only by their reputations and achievements, were enigmatic figures.

The Summer Guardian was known for her fiery passion and direct manner.

Therefore, she stood out as the most unpredictable among the four guardians, a free spirit unshackled by the norms.

She was not as disciplined as the Winter Guardian, as diligent as the Autumn Guardian, nor was she as gentle as the Spring Guardian.

It was widely believed that no one in the Magus World could tame or contain her whims.

If she chose to stay and observe a while longer, it was certain that none of the five tower masters would have the audacity to urge her departure.

In the trial space, Sein finally found a relatively empty and safe area to land and began tallying the spoils of his expedition.

The assorted space rings and magic equipment were too numerous to count in a short time, so Sein set them aside for the time being.

Instead, he focused on the substantial points he had accumulated thus far.

14,760 points!

Given that this was nearly double his initial score, it was no surprise that Sein had soared to the top of the real-time rankings.

Nevertheless, the conspicuous golden light emitting from his badge was a nuisance.

Even in this open area, its radiant glow was a beacon to any nearby initiates, potentially revealing his location.

Considering the heavy losses incurred by the Divine Tower of Shadow, Sein anticipated they would seek retribution.

“It seems like the only option now is to dismantle this divine tower badge and find a way to conceal the golden light,” Sein mused.

He had previously dismantled the badge from the Divine Tower of Verdant Spring, even developing special functions for them.

As a skilled alchemist, he was confident in his ability to address this problem.

However, as soon as Sein retrieved a simple alchemy table from his space bangle, a shadow arrow whizzed by, narrowly missing him.

If not for the detect magic embedded in his Solar Eye Mask, he might have been caught off guard.

The assailant’s ability to track and remain concealed was impressive, having silently followed Sein to this location!

“You think you can wreak havoc in our Divine Tower of Shadow’s territory and leave unscathed? Seems like the lessons from the last regional war weren’t enough for you!” The hidden assailant sneered, after identifying Sein as an initiate from the Divine Tower of Verdant Spring through his divine tower badge.

“Hehe... After that intense battle and using a Levitate spell to flee here, I bet your focus and mana reserves must be drained, right? Prepare to meet your end! Your points will be mine!”

A flurry of shadow arrows shot toward Sein from multiple directions.

“You think so?” Sein asked after narrowly evading one of the shadow arrows.

He suddenly looked up, his gaze fixating on a large tree about tens of meters away.

In just the blink of an eye, six points of blinding golden light lit up on the surface of Sein’s golden mask.
